Round Two! So you’ve mastered Warsong Gulch? Yea, well don’t sweat it, no one really does. Arathi Basin (AB) is the second battleground you encounter in World of Warcraft. You can enter this battleground at level 20 and the brackets are the same as Warsong – 20-29, 30-39, 40-49, 50-59, 60-69, and 70. Both true entrances [...]...

Welcome Noobs! This is going to be your primer and introduction to Warsong Gulch – one of the battlegrounds for PvP in World of Warcraft. Warsong Gulch, or WSG, is the first battleground you will have access to in World of Warcraft. There are two ways you can enter WSG, one is through the Battlemaster located [...]...
